This is a tutorial for a beautiful, practical and simple pillow cushion. It is a fabric DIY home decoration item. The knitting and fabric are combined perfectly, creating a great effect.
Firstly, print the pattern. Transfer the pattern onto the fabric.
Knit the woolen thread, use running stitch, 6 – 8 stitches. (It is necessary to test whether the wool will fade first. Wash the wool together with white fabric.)
Fix the woolen thread along the pattern line. Embroider the woolen thread onto the fabric with the invisible stitch (using embroidery thread of the same color as the wool).
This is the effect after embroidery.
Now start making the cushion. Cut a square of 50 * 50 cm, with the pattern in the center.
Align the fabric of the front and back of the cushion and fix it with pins. (The back fabric is 50 * 40 cm.)
Align another piece of fabric on the back. (Another piece of fabric is 50 * 30 cm.)
Sew around. Overlock around.
This is the effect after turning it to the front.
Knit another woolen thread, with a length that can go around the cushion. Add a few more stitches than the original 6 – 8 stitches.
Embroider the woolen thread around the cushion. The wool – embroidered cushion is completed.
This is the effect after stuffing the pillow core.
